{Simple, Sweet & Tangy} Lemon Squares
Buttery. Sweet. Perfectly tangy. These Sweet & Tangy Lemon Squares are a wonderful combination of buttery shortbread and luscious lemon curd! This simple and stress-free 6 ingredient recipe requires one bowl, a whisk, and less than 10 minutes to prep! They are sunshine in dessert form!
Prep Time 10 minutes mins
Cook Time 45 minutes mins
Course Breakfast, Dessert, Snack
Cuisine American
Shortbread Crust 1 1/2 cup Flour 1/4 cup Granulated Sugar 1/2 cup Butter, softened pinch of salt Lemon Curd 1 1/2 cup Granulated Sugar 4 Eggs large 2 tbsp Flour 3 Lemons pinch of salt 1-2 tbsp Icing Sugar for decorating!
Shortbread Crust Start by preheating your oven to 350F (325F convection bake). Line a 9"x 9” baking pan with parchment paper.
In a large bowl, use clean hands to blend butter into 1/4 cup sugar and 1 1/2 cups flour until a mixture resembling wet sand forms.
Press mixture evenly into the bottom of the pan. Bake for ~20 minutes or until edges are golden brown.
Lemon Curd While crust is baking, whisk together eggs, sugar, and flour.
Once crust is baked and removed from oven, whisk lemon juice into egg mixture and pour over the crust.
Return to baking pan to the oven for another ~25-30 minutes or until set to a slight wobble.
Allow to cool completely in baking pan. Remove from pan, cut into squares, and decorate with icing sugar!
Sofia’s Tips:
These lemon squares can rest in the fridge for 1-2h before cutting for a chilled treat !
For a clean cut , dip knife in hot water and wipe clean between each cut
Any left over lemon squares can be stored overnight at room temperature and then transferred to the fridge for additional storage!
